24" Dell U2412M IPS 1920x1200 LED Monitor $293.00 @ B&H
 
24" Dell U2412M Ultrasharp IPS 1920x1200 LED Monitor $293.00 + Free Shipping!
Product Highlights

DVI-D with HDCP, DisplayPort, VGA
4 x USB 2.0 Ports
1920 x 1200 @ 60 Hz Resolution
1000:1 Contrast Ratio
300cd/m2 Brightness
8ms Response Time
0.27 x 0.27mm Pixel Pitch
178 and 178 Degree Viewing Angle
16.7 Million Colors
Security Port & Anti-Theft Stand Lock
